Ain (Ein)

Ain, Child of Eidolon

Ain is the child of Eidolon and is the planned heir to become Leader of Homeworld and the CityState when Eidolon passes.
  Eidolon had come to the decision that they needed to produce Ain, after believing that Obril would not be suitable.

Physical Description

Ain has pale skin and short, white hair as well as red eyes; which are traits caused by their Albinism.

Apparel & Accessories

Ain wears white robes and a golden mask similar to Eidolon. They also wear grey gloves and boots.

Personality Characteristics

Virtues & Personality perks

  • Charming - Ain is very polite and can be pleasant to talk to.
  • Dedicated - Ain is very devoted to continuing Eidolon's work.
  • Self-reliant - While they are forced to be dependant on Eidolon and the Administration for many things, Ain can be left to their own devices to do their own work and studies.
 

Vices & Personality flaws

  • Apathetic - With their life mostly planned out, Ain finds it difficult to be excited about much and can get easily disinterested in things.
  • Materialistic - Ain enjoys the fancier things in life due to having been constantly surrounded by that sort of thing.

Likes & Dislikes

LIKES:

  • History - Ain is very interested in hooman history and enjoys reading up on it.
  • Games - While Ain doesn't have too much time for it, they enjoy playing cards and board games. They mostly play solitaire.
  • Night - Ain prefers the nighttime as it's calmer and isn't as intense on their eyes. They also enjoy star-watching.
  • People-watching - Ain developed an interest in people-watching after discovering the camera system that Eidolon had that observed the Citadel and areas in the Citystate.

DISLIKES:

  • Sun - Ain is not fond of the sun as it's too strong on their eyes and skin.
  • Uncleaniness - Ain is very particular in cleaning up their living space, and gets very uncomfortable if there's mess.

Contacts & Relations

  • Eidolon - Ain holds a lot of respect for Eidolon and finds their feats to be impressive (the ones that they've been told about). However, Ain does low-key wish that Eidolon was a bit more affectionate as a parent and does their best to try and give Eidolon reasons to be proud of them.
  • Obril - Ain was mostly unaware of the existence of their sibling until near the end of the civil war when they met for the first time. Their relationship is polite but mostly awkward.
